Scranton Cultural Center at the Masonic Temple | History & the arts under one roof in Scranton
The Scranton Cultural Center at the Masonic Temple (SCCMT) in Scranton, PA serves as a regional hub for performing arts, education, and community events. Housed in a stunning historic structure that once served as The Masonic Temple and Scottish Rite Cathedral, the center continues to honor its architectural legacy while embracing its expanded role in modern cultural life.
A Versatile Venue for Arts & Events
SCCMT features two theaters, a grand ballroom, meeting rooms, and other event spaces. It hosts national tours of Broadway musicals, concerts, and productions by top regional companies. While welcoming thousands of visitors each year, the Center also remains the headquarters for Masonic activity in the region, continuing a tradition dating back to its origins.
Education, Engagement & Community Impact
The Scranton Cultural Center is deeply committed to arts education and accessibility. Through arts-integrated programming, it offers enriching experiences for school districts, homeschool groups, charter schools, and the broader community. The Center’s goal is to inspire creativity and connection through inclusive programming that appeals to audiences of all ages.
